Microsoft’s Foundry Local: A New Player in Desktop AI

Desktop setup with AI dashboard on monitor and neural network graphic on laptop, showcasing Microsoft’s Foundry Local for offline AI.

Microsoft has introduced Foundry Local, a platform designed to bring AI capabilities to Windows and macOS desktops without requiring an internet connection. It aims to enable developers to create applications that run locally, leveraging existing hardware for tasks like text generation, translation, or automation. While Foundry Local offers a structured approach to offline AI, it enters a competitive field with established open-source tools like Ollama, LM Studio, and Jan. Let’s explore what Foundry Local brings to the table, its features, and how it fits into the local AI landscape, based on its and .


What is Foundry Local?

Foundry Local is Microsoft’s solution for running AI models directly on your desktop, bypassing the need for cloud services. It’s a desktop-focused version of their Azure AI Foundry, tailored for individual Windows and macOS users. The platform allows developers to build applications that process data locally, prioritizing data privacy and offline functionality. While it shares goals with open-source tools like Ollama, LM Studio, and Jan, Foundry Local takes a more proprietary approach, which shapes its strengths and limitations.


Key Features of Foundry Local

Foundry Local offers several features aimed at developers and businesses looking to integrate AI into their desktop applications:

  • Offline Functionality: Foundry Local enables AI applications to run without an internet connection, making it suitable for environments like remote offices or areas with limited connectivity.

  • Data Privacy: By processing data on-device, it helps keep sensitive information secure, which is valuable for industries like healthcare or finance.

  • Cost Efficiency: Using existing hardware, Foundry Local eliminates the need for cloud subscriptions, potentially reducing costs for users.

  • Performance: Local processing can offer faster response times by avoiding cloud latency, though performance depends on the user’s hardware.

  • Model Options: It provides a catalog of pre-optimized models, with support for customization, compatible with hardware like NVIDIA GPUs, AMD GPUs, or Apple Silicon.

  • Integration Tools: Foundry Local includes a command-line interface, SDKs for Python and JavaScript, and an OpenAI-compatible API, allowing developers to incorporate AI into existing projects.

However, these features are not unique, as tools like Ollama, LM Studio, and Jan offer similar capabilities, often with more extensive model support and community-driven updates.


Getting Started with Foundry Local

Setting up Foundry Local is straightforward but may require some technical steps:

  • On Windows: Install via PowerShell or Command Prompt using a command like winget install foundrylocal, or download the installer from the .

  • On macOS: Use Homebrew with commands like brew tap microsoft/foundrylocal and brew install foundrylocal, or download the macOS installer from GitHub.

Requirements:

  • A Windows or macOS computer, possibly requiring admin privileges for installation.

  • Optional: Advanced hardware like NVIDIA or AMD GPUs, Qualcomm Snapdragon, or Apple Silicon for improved performance.

  • An internet connection for initial setup and model downloads, though not needed for ongoing use.

Once installed, users can run models via the command line, such as launching a text-generation model with a simple command. For developers, integrating Foundry Local into applications involves using its SDKs or APIs, though some may find the setup less intuitive than alternatives like Jan or Ollama, which prioritize user-friendly interfaces.


Where Foundry Local Fits In

Foundry Local enters a crowded field where open-source tools have set a high bar:

  • Privacy and Security: Like its open-source counterparts, Foundry Local keeps data on-device, which is critical for sensitive applications. However, its proprietary nature may raise questions for users who prefer the transparency of tools like Ollama.

  • Offline Use: Its ability to function offline aligns with LM Studio and Jan, making it a viable option for disconnected environments, though it doesn’t offer significant advantages over these tools.

  • Performance and Ease of Use: Foundry Local’s performance depends heavily on hardware, and its setup can feel complex compared to the streamlined experiences of Ollama or Jan. LM Studio, for instance, is known for its ease of integration and broad model support.

  • Community and Ecosystem: Open-source tools benefit from active communities that drive frequent updates and model variety. Foundry Local’s ecosystem, while backed by Microsoft, is smaller and less dynamic, which may limit its appeal for some developers.

Feedback from users reflects mixed sentiments. One X user noted, “Foundry Local gets the job done, but Ollama’s simplicity is hard to beat.” Another commented, “It’s fine for basic tasks, but LM Studio feels more polished.” We have explored Foundry Local, but open-source alternatives often steal the spotlight for their flexibility.


Potential Use Cases

Foundry Local supports a range of applications, though its competitors offer similar capabilities:

  • Content Creation: It can power apps that generate text or summarize documents offline, similar to what Ollama achieves with broader model options.

  • Language Translation: Developers can build translation tools, though LM Studio’s integration with diverse models may offer more versatility.

  • Healthcare: On-device processing suits privacy-sensitive applications, but Jan’s open-source transparency may be preferred in some cases.

  • Education: Foundry Local can support offline learning tools for areas with limited internet, though LM Studio’s efficiency on lower-spec devices is a strong alternative.

  • Automation: It can enable task automation in disconnected settings, but Ollama’s lightweight design often makes it a more practical choice.

For example, a small business might use Foundry Local for an offline chatbot, but Ollama could provide a quicker setup. Similarly, a teacher in a rural area might opt for Jan’s intuitive tools over Foundry Local’s steeper learning curve.


Looking Ahead with Foundry Local

Microsoft’s Foundry Local is a solid attempt to bring AI to the desktop, offering offline functionality, privacy, and cost efficiency. However, it operates in a competitive space where open-source tools like Ollama, LM Studio, and Jan have established strong footholds with their flexibility, community support, and ease of use. Foundry Local’s proprietary approach and smaller ecosystem may limit its appeal for some, but it could still find a niche for users comfortable with Microsoft’s ecosystem and seeking a structured offline AI solution.


Frequently Asked Questions (FAQs)

Foundry Local is a platform for running AI models on Windows and macOS desktops without an internet connection. It supports tasks like text generation and automation, focusing on privacy and cost efficiency.

Foundry Local offers offline AI with a proprietary approach, while open-source tools like Ollama, LM Studio, and Jan provide broader model support and community-driven updates. Each has strengths depending on user needs.

Foundry Local works on Windows and macOS computers, with optional support for GPUs like NVIDIA or AMD for better performance. An internet connection is needed for initial setup but not for ongoing use.

Foundry Local is free to install and use, leveraging existing hardware to avoid cloud costs. However, setup and model downloads may require time and resources.

Foundry Local suits applications like content creation, translation, healthcare data analysis, and automation in offline settings, though alternatives like LM Studio may offer more flexibility for some tasks.

Install Foundry Local via command-line tools or GitHub installers for Windows or macOS. Follow Microsoft’s guide for setup, and explore SDKs for integrating AI into apps.

Foundry Local integrates with Microsoft’s ecosystem and offers structured support, but open-source tools like Jan or Ollama may appeal to users seeking simplicity or transparency.

To explore Foundry Local, visit the or . For tailored advice on choosing the right local AI solution for your needs, contact the experts at to navigate the best options for powering your offline AI projects.